The significance of this solar eclipse is that it has been almost 100 years since the last time the USA has had an eclipse cover so many states. The solar eclipse of June 8, 1918 went from Washington state to Florida, which is close to the path that this eclipse will be taking. The last time an eclipse went through the continental USA was back in February 26, 1979. Basically, for most people living in the USA, this is probably the best opportunity to see a solar elipse until August 24, 2045. Of course, anyone who will be around for the September 14, 2099, might get to see the end of our civilization as well. Calling it The Great American Eclipse is appropriate, but as you can see, solar eclipses do happen on a regular basis, if you count time by generations.

Eclipses have an interesting lore around them.

“The birds flew about in evident distress and terror, the domestic fowls ran about in all directions cackling as in a fright,” Thomas wrote. “Horses galloped around their pastures neighing; while the horned cattle which seemed more affected than the rest, tore up the earth with their horns and feet in madness — all this uproar was followed by the silence of midnight.” ~ https://www.ohio.com/akron/lifestyle/local-history-solar-eclipse-was-deadly-prophecy-in-1806

The above quote was a description of the 1806 eclipse as it passed over Rhode Island. What made the lore about this eclipse special was, a woman of the Wyandot American Indians had made a prediction that the sky would go dark soon. Fearing that she was a witch, they dragged her down to a river and hung her from a tree that leaned over the river. When the eclipse did happen, the people involved feared that retribution was about to come for their bad deed.

The Virgin of the Apocolypse


The main happening for this year's The Event is the Revelation 12 Sign. If you are unfamiliar with the last book of the Bible, The Revelation of John, it is either a play-by-play of the end of the world or a commentary on the state of the Roman Empire during the time that Christians and Jews were being persecuted. If you want to make a doomsday prophecy, having it line up with something in Revelation is a sure fire way to get people to pay attention.

The verses in focus are the beginning of Revelation 12.

Revelation 12: 1-2 - The Woman and the Dragon ~ King James Version

12 And there appeared a great wonder in heaven; a woman clothed with the sun, and the moon under her feet, and upon her head a crown of twelve stars:
2 And she being with child cried, travailing in birth, and pained to be delivered.

Revelation 12: 1-2 - The Woman and the Dragon ~ English Standard Version

12 And a great sign appeared in heaven: a woman clothed with the sun, with the moon under her feet, and on her head a crown of twelve stars. 2 She was pregnant and was crying out in birth pains and the agony of giving birth.

But, what you should do is read the entire Revelation 12. Because this sign is also the start of the Apocalypse. The final battle between heaven and hell and the destruction of man-kind.

17 Then the dragon was enraged at the woman and went off to wage war against the rest of her offspring—those who keep God’s commands and hold fast their testimony about Jesus.

Why do people think that they'll see the sign on September 23, 2017? On that date, the constellation Virgo will have the constellation Leo above her head. This will create a crown. And joining the constellation stars will be Mercury, Mars, Venus making it a crown of 12 stars. On September 23, it will appear that the moon is at the feat of Virgo and the sun will provide a cloak (cloaks being worn over the shoulder) of light. And Jupiter has been taking a retrograde path that sees it going through the constellation Virgo as a representation of her womb.
